Patch-ID# 103395-01 Keywords: bsc rje bad crc Synopsis: SunLink BSC RJE 6.0: Frames with bad CRC not discarded Date: May/08/96 Solaris Release: 1.x SunOS release: 4.1.1, 4.1.2, 4.1.3 Unbundled Product: SunLink BSC RJE Unbundled Release: 6.0 BugId's fixed with this patch: 1190997 Changes incorporated in this version: 1190997 Relevant Architectures: sparc Patches accumulated and obsoleted by this patch: Patches which conflict with this patch: Patches required with this patch: Obsoleted by: Files included with this patch: sunlink/bscrje/sys/sun4/OBJ/zs_bsctables.o Problem Description: (Revision 01) ------------- 1190997: Frames with bad CRC not discarded The BSC driver mishandles an error from a noisy line for a transparent intermediate block. A DLE character is mangled by noise, causing an ITB to be missed. But when the driver sees the next STX it stops reading the line and sends a NAK. When it resumes reading it picks up the second half of the block and NAKs it also, for a BCC error. The host retransmitted for each NAK, resulting in one too many copies of the block arriving. The BSC driver has been modified to allow control characters in text blocks, and let the BCC catch any errors at the end of the entire block. Page 17 of GA27-3004-2 (IBM BSC General Info) says: "Any station receiving a control character within a text block treats the control character or sequence as data and waits for the BCC to detect a possible error. If an error is detected, normal recovery procedures are used. If no error is detected, the transmission is treated as valid data." -------------------------------- Patch Installation Instructions: -------------------------------- Login as root for this procedure.
